AVEVA™ Communication Drivers

Export and import the Gateway item data

  • Last UpdatedAug 19, 2024
  • 2 minute read

The Export and Import commands on the shortcut menu enable you to export and import the Gateway Communication Driver item data to and from a CSV file, after the configuration of the Device Items has been completed. These commands will allow you to perform an off-line, large-scale edit on the item data configured for a controller, and import what has been edited back into the controller configuration.

The Export and Import features on the shortcut menu of the Device Items dialog box enable you to export and import the Gateway Communication Driver device item data to and from a CSV file, after the configuration of the Device Items has been completed. These features provide you with the following capabilities:

  • Archive lists of device items.

  • Bring an archived list of device items into the Device Items dialog box when you need to utilize or reconfigure any of the device items on the archived list.

  • Perform an off-line, large-scale edit on the item data configured for a PLC.

    • Import what has been edited back into the PLC configuration.

Export device items

When you want to archive a list of device items, use the Export feature in the Device Items configuration view.

  1. Right-click anywhere in the Device Items configuration view, and select the Export command from the shortcut menu.

  2. Select the folder into which the list is to be saved.

  3. Name the list to be exported.

  4. Click the Save button.

    The entire list is saved as a .csv file.

Import device items

The Import feature in the Device Items configuration view is used to import an archived list of device items into the configuration view.

  1. Right-click anywhere in the Device Items configuration view, and select the Import command from the shortcut menu.

  2. Select the archived list (.csv file) to be imported, and click Open.

    The entire list is imported into the Device Items configuration view.

    Note: Duplicate items with the same Item References are ignored during import. Duplicate items with different Item References cause a dialog box to be displayed, in which you must make a selection.

    Resolving Item Names from Clients

    Gateway Communication Driver resolves item names from its clients at runtime in the following order:

    System items (those prefixed with $SYS$) > Device items (those defined in the Device Items configuration view) > All other items (validated directly from the PLC device)
